How to Use

Installation begins by identifying an available PWM or DC fan header on your motherboard, then connecting the FH10 hub's main input cable to that header. Route the hub to a centralized location within your chassis, preferably near the fans you intend to connect, then connect your individual fans to the numbered ports on the hub using standard fan connectors. Ensure each fan connector is fully seated to establish proper electrical contact. The hub will automatically distribute the PWM control signal from your motherboard to all connected fans, allowing your BIOS or fan control software to regulate speeds as if each fan were connected directly to the motherboard.

For optimal performance, verify that the total current draw of all connected fans does not exceed the hub's capacity (typically 10A total), and avoid daisy-chaining multiple hubs as this can degrade signal quality. If you are mixing 3-pin DC fans with 4-pin PWM fans, ensure your motherboard is set to PWM mode in BIOS, as DC fans will operate at full speed when receiving PWM signals. Test fan operation immediately after installation by entering BIOS and confirming that fan speed adjustments are reflected across all connected fans. If a fan does not respond to speed changes, reseat its connector on the hub and verify the fan is functioning independently by testing it on a direct motherboard header.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can the Deepcool FH10 control fans independently or only as a group?

The FH10 distributes the same PWM signal to all 10 ports simultaneously, meaning all connected fans will operate at the same speed. However, your motherboard BIOS or fan control software can adjust this single PWM signal, which affects all fans together. For true independent fan control, you would need separate motherboard headers or multiple hubs. This design is ideal for setups where all fans should operate in sync, such as matching intake and exhaust speeds.

What is the maximum current capacity and how do I calculate if my fans will exceed it?

The FH10 typically supports up to 1A per individual fan port with a total system capacity of approximately 10A. To verify compatibility, check each fan's specifications for current draw (listed in amps on the fan packaging or manual), then sum the current of all fans you plan to connect. Most case fans draw 0.3-0.8A, while high-performance fans may draw up to 1A. If your total exceeds 10A, you will need to use multiple hubs or connect some fans directly to motherboard headers.

Can I use the FH10 with both 3-pin DC and 4-pin PWM fans simultaneously?

Yes, the FH10 accepts both connector types on the same hub. However, all fans will receive the same control signal. If your motherboard is in PWM mode, 3-pin DC fans will operate at full speed regardless of PWM adjustments, while 4-pin PWM fans will respond normally. For mixed setups, consider grouping DC fans and PWM fans on separate hubs if you need different speed profiles, or keep the motherboard in a mode that accommodates your primary fan type.

How long are the cables on the FH10 and can I extend them?

The main input cable is typically 30cm long, while individual fan ports have short connectors. You can extend the main input cable using standard 4-pin PWM extension cables available separately, though longer cables may introduce signal degradation. For individual fan connections, use quality fan extension cables rated for PWM signals. Avoid extending cables excessively beyond 1-2 meters total length, as this increases electromagnetic interference and may cause fan speed instability or monitoring errors.

Will the FH10 work with my motherboard if it has limited fan headers?

Yes, the FH10 is specifically designed for motherboards with limited fan headers. It requires only one PWM or DC header and can control up to 10 fans from that single connection. This makes it ideal for older motherboards with only 2-3 headers or newer boards where all headers are already occupied. Verify your motherboard has at least one available fan header before purchasing, and check if it supports PWM mode if you are using 4-pin fans.
